# awesome-prometheus-alerts **Repository Path**: ploynomail/awesome-prometheus-alerts ## Basic Information - **Project Name**: awesome-prometheus-alerts - **Description**: No description available - **Primary Language**: Unknown - **License**: CC-BY-4.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2021-03-17 - **Last Updated**: 2024-05-29 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 👋 Awesome Prometheus Alerts [![Awesome](https://awesome.re/badge-flat.svg)](https://awesome.re) > Most alerting rules are common to every Prometheus setup. We need a place to find them all. 🤘 🚨 📊 Collection available here: **[https://awesome-prometheus-alerts.grep.to](https://awesome-prometheus-alerts.grep.to)** ## ✨ Contents - [Rules](#-rules) - [Contributing](#-contributing) - [Improvements](#-improvements) - [Help us](#-show-your-support) - [License](#-license) ## 🚨 Rules #### Basic resource monitoring - [Prometheus self-monitoring](https://awesome-prometheus-alerts.grep.to/rules#prometheus-internals) - [Host/Hardware](https://awesome-prometheus-alerts.grep.to/rules#host-and-hardware) - [Docker Containers](https://awesome-prometheus-alerts.grep.to/rules#docker-containers) - [Blackbox](https://awesome-prometheus-alerts.grep.to/rules#blackbox) - [Windows](https://awesome-prometheus-alerts.grep.to/rules#windows-server) - [VMWare](https://awesome-prometheus-alerts.grep.to/rules#vmware) - [Netdata](https://awesome-prometheus-alerts.grep.to/rules#netdata) #### Databases and brokers - [MySQL](https://awesome-prometheus-alerts.grep.to/rules#mysql) - [PostgreSQL](https://awesome-prometheus-alerts.grep.to/rules#postgresql) - [PGBouncer](https://awesome-prometheus-alerts.grep.to/rules#pgbouncer) - [Redis](https://awesome-prometheus-alerts.grep.to/rules#redis) - [MongoDB](https://awesome-prometheus-alerts.grep.to/rules#mongodb) - [RabbitMQ](https://awesome-prometheus-alerts.grep.to/rules#rabbitmq) - [Elasticsearch](https://awesome-prometheus-alerts.grep.to/rules#elasticsearch) - [Cassandra](https://awesome-prometheus-alerts.grep.to/rules#cassandra) - [Zookeeper](https://awesome-prometheus-alerts.grep.to/rules#zookeeper) - [Kafka](https://awesome-prometheus-alerts.grep.to/rules#kafka) #### Reverse proxies and load balancers - [Nginx](https://awesome-prometheus-alerts.grep.to/rules#nginx) - [Apache](https://awesome-prometheus-alerts.grep.to/rules#apache) - [HaProxy](https://awesome-prometheus-alerts.grep.to/rules#haproxy) - [Traefik](https://awesome-prometheus-alerts.grep.to/rules#traefik) #### Runtimes - [PHP-FPM](https://awesome-prometheus-alerts.grep.to/rules#php-fpm) - [JVM](https://awesome-prometheus-alerts.grep.to/rules#jvm) - [Sidekiq](https://awesome-prometheus-alerts.grep.to/rules#sidekiq) #### Orchestrators - [Kubernetes](https://awesome-prometheus-alerts.grep.to/rules#kubernetes) - [Nomad](https://awesome-prometheus-alerts.grep.to/rules#nomad) - [Consul](https://awesome-prometheus-alerts.grep.to/rules#consul) - [Etcd](https://awesome-prometheus-alerts.grep.to/rules#etcd) - [Linkerd](https://awesome-prometheus-alerts.grep.to/rules#linkerd) - [Istio](https://awesome-prometheus-alerts.grep.to/rules#istio) #### Network and storage - [Ceph](https://awesome-prometheus-alerts.grep.to/rules#ceph) - [ZFS](https://awesome-prometheus-alerts.grep.to/rules#zfs) - [OpenEBS](https://awesome-prometheus-alerts.grep.to/rules#openebs) - [Minio](https://awesome-prometheus-alerts.grep.to/rules#minio) - [SSL/TLS](https://awesome-prometheus-alerts.grep.to/rules#ssl/tls) - [Juniper](https://awesome-prometheus-alerts.grep.to/rules#juniper) - [CoreDNS](https://awesome-prometheus-alerts.grep.to/rules#coredns) #### Other - [Thanos](https://awesome-prometheus-alerts.grep.to/rules#thanos) ## 🤝 Contributing Contributions from community (you!) are most welcome! There are many ways to contribute: writing code, alerting rules, documentation, reporting issues, discussing better error tracking... [Instructions here](CONTRIBUTING.md) ## 🏋️ Improvements - Create an alert rule builder in Jekyll for custom alerts (severity, thresholds, instances...) - Add resolution suggestions to rule descriptions, for faster incident resolution ([#85](https://github.com/samber/awesome-prometheus-alerts/issues/85)). ## 💫 Show your support Give a ⭐️ if this project helped you! [![support us](https://c5.patreon.com/external/logo/become_a_patron_button.png)](https://www.patreon.com/samber) ## 👏 Thanks Gratitude for the Gitlab operation team that provided 50+ rules. \o/ ## 📝 License [![CC4](https://mirrors.creativecommons.org/presskit/cc.srr.primary.svg)](https://creativecommons.org/licenses/by/4.0/legalcode) Licensed under the Creative Commons 4.0 License, see LICENSE file for more detail.